Web前端需要研究的内容(计划)

[b][size=x-large]JS技术框架[/size][/b]

[b]CommonJS[/b]
 CommonJS API定义很多普通应用程序(主要指非浏览器的应用)使用的API,从而填补了这个空白。它的终极目标是提供一个类似Python,Ruby和Java标 准库。这样的话,开发者可以使用CommonJS API编写应用程序,然后这些应用可以运行在不同的JavaScript解释器和不同的主机环境中。在兼容CommonJS的系统中,你可以实用 JavaScript程序开发:
参见:[url]http://www.commonjs.org[/url]

[b] jquery [/b]
不多说,必学习:
[url]http://jquery.org[/url]

[b] backbone [/b]
JS MVC框架:
[url]http://documentcloud.github.com/backbone/#[/url]

[b]requirejs[/b]
JS加载,RequireJS 是一个 JavaScript 文件和模块加载器,特别为浏览器优化,同时也可运行在 Rhino 和 Node 环境中。
[url]http://requirejs.org[/url]
另一个小型的AMD框架:almond[url]https://github.com/jrburke/almond[/url].
SeaJS是淘宝团队开发的,其定位是一个适用于浏览器端的 JavaScript 模块加载器。好像对seajs的评价更高,API简洁清晰:[url]http://seajs.org[/url]

SeaJS采用CMD规范定义模块,了解CMD:[url]https://github.com/seajs/seajs/issues/242[/url]

这里讲的相关资源较多:
[url]http://gavin.iteye.com/blog/1446277[/url]

[b]underscore.js[/b]

Underscore是一个非常实用的JavaScript库,提供许多编程时需要的功能的支持,他在不扩展任何JavaScript的原生对象的情况下提供很多实用的功能。
参见[url]http://cavenfeng.iteye.com/blog/1552673[/url]

[b]nodejs[/b]
神器,不得不学了:
[url]http://nodejs.org/[/url]
npm是node的包管理器,我们在开发nodejs应用程序的过程中,可能需要依赖许许多多的第三方模块以提高开发效率,那么此时,我们就需要npm来辅助安装所需package。
npm的官方网站为:[url]http://npmjs.org/[/url]

[b][size=x-large]CSS技术框架[/size][/b]

[b] 1.Bootstrap [/b]
twitter工程师贡献的一个CSSWeb设计库,经典
[url]http://twitter.github.com/bootstrap/index.html[/url]

a)生成Bootstrap按钮的工具
[url]http://charliepark.org/bootstrap_buttons/[/url]
b)

[b]LESS[/b]
[url] http://lesscss.org/[/url]
a)比较LESS和SASS的区别
http://coding.smashingmagazine.com/2011/09/09/an-introduction-to-less-and-comparison-to-sass/

[b][size=x-large]资源成品[/size][/b]

[b]54cxy[/b]

提供了很多现成的模板,很多,很好
[url]http://www.54cxy.com/[/url]

[b]kopyov[/b]
现成样式,包括多种风格
[url]http://themes.kopyov.com/?theme=Its%20Brain%20-%20admin%20theme[/url]

[b]glyphicons[/b]
提供各式各样的ICON小图标
[url]http://glyphicons.com/[/url]


[b][size=x-large]杂项[/size][/b]

[b]sizzlejs[/b]
sizzlejs是一个纯JS实现的CSS高速选择器引擎,其性能要胜过目前网络上大多数的选择器引擎,它是一个独立的js库。jQuery官方测试结果为:sizzlejs的查询速度相比jQuery的选择器引擎提升了49%。
[url]http://sizzlejs.com/[/url]
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值